From: Florian Weimer <fw@sourceware.org> To: glibc-cvs@sourceware.org Subject: [glibc] elf: Remove _dl_sysdep_open_object hook function Date: Thu, 1 Feb 2024 07:59:25 +0000 (GMT) [thread overview] Message-ID: <20240201075925.1DB3438582A9@sourceware.org> (raw) https://sourceware.org/git/gitweb.cgi?p=glibc.git;h=7c8df0b9441e34928f2d7d70531e3d55e016c32e commit 7c8df0b9441e34928f2d7d70531e3d55e016c32e Author: Florian Weimer <fweimer@redhat.com> Date: Thu Feb 1 08:59:02 2024 +0100 elf: Remove _dl_sysdep_open_object hook function It is currently not used by any target. Diff: --- elf/dl-load.c | 15 --------------- elf/dl-sysdep-open.h | 45 --------------------------------------------- 2 files changed, 60 deletions(-) diff --git a/elf/dl-load.c b/elf/dl-load.c index ce8fdea302..a34cb3559c 100644 --- a/elf/dl-load.c +++ b/elf/dl-load.c @@ -72,7 +72,6 @@ struct filebuf #include <dl-map-segments.h> #include <dl-unmap-segments.h> #include <dl-machine-reject-phdr.h> -#include <dl-sysdep-open.h> #include <dl-prop.h> #include <not-cancel.h> @@ -2091,20 +2090,6 @@ _dl_map_object (struct link_map *loader, const char *name, &loader->l_runpath_dirs, &realname, &fb, loader, LA_SER_RUNPATH, &found_other_class); - if (fd == -1) - { - realname = _dl_sysdep_open_object (name, namelen, &fd); - if (realname != NULL) - { - fd = open_verify (realname, fd, - &fb, loader ?: GL(dl_ns)[nsid]._ns_loaded, - LA_SER_CONFIG, mode, &found_other_class, - false); - if (fd == -1) - free (realname); - } - } - #ifdef USE_LDCONFIG if (fd == -1 && (__glibc_likely ((mode & __RTLD_SECURE) == 0) diff --git a/elf/dl-sysdep-open.h b/elf/dl-sysdep-open.h deleted file mode 100644 index 73ebc1086e..0000000000 --- a/elf/dl-sysdep-open.h +++ /dev/null @@ -1,45 +0,0 @@ -/* System-specific call to open a shared object by name.
